Charm For Restful Sleep
With Sagittarius season comes the shortening of days. The sun greets us earlier and the moon rises sooner, a change that can inevitably affect our sleeping patterns. As Nikki Van De Car writes in Wellness Witch Healing Potions, Soothing Spells, and Empowering Rituals for Magical Self-Care; “We all need sleep to survive, and yet it is elusive. Insomnia is a fact of life for as many as one in three people today, while we are kept awake by our fear, our anxieties, our long list of things left undone.” You might notice that with daylight savings time, your sleep schedule is off-kilter. Consider this charm when looking for remedies to a restful sleep, courtesy of Wellness Witch:
1 tablespoon dried lavender
1 tablespoon dried vervain
1 tablespoon dried yarrow
1 tablespoon dried lemon balm or catnip
Amethyst, for a gentle and restful sleep
You can adjust your charm according to your needs: add some holly if you’d like to invite prophetic dreams, cowslip if you would like to be visited by loved ones who have passed, or betony if you require protection from nightmares.
Stir your herbs together and let them charge in the full moon, surrounded by your chosen crystal or crystals. Burn some sage if desired, just to be sure you have warded off anything that might want to keep you awake. Gather everything into a small cloth bag and place it lovingly at your side as you prepare for sleep. Change it out every full moon as needed.

A Tarot Card for Sagittarius
All zodiac signs are ruled by a tarot card from the Major Arcana. The tarot card associated with Sagittarius season is the Temperance card. Let’s take a close look at this card from the Black Tarot: An Ancestral Awakening Deck and Guidebook deck from Nyasha Williams.
Traits: Contentment, balance, yes
A woman in a kitchen tempers chocolate, heating and cooling the chocolate to stabilize it, creating a glossy finish. She works to create balance, finding the perfect equilibrium. Tempering takes patience, understanding the gravity of a stable personal foundation, and collaboration with the community.
The Temperance card calls for moderation. Do not act in haste, as the material and spiritual aspects of a situation must be considered in equal measure.
When the Temperance card is pulled, it is time to consider the following:
- What do you bring to the table?
- Do you actively engage with the viewpoints of your echo chambers?
- Have you considered compromising?
